Ext JS Tree和Grid结合应用示例
Ext 树和表格的结合应用真的挺有意思,是在需要展示层级数据时。你可以用Ext Tree展示层级结构,比如文件夹、项目或者组织结构,用户还可以通过拖拽、展开、折叠等操作来互动。再加上Ext Grid,就能把数据以表格的形式呈现出来,支持排序、过滤、分页等常见功能。两者结合之后,用户在树上做的选择会直接影响表格内容,表格也能反过来更新树的显示。这种交互体验可以应用在多项目里,比如文件管理系统或者任务管理系统。,Ext JS 中的TreePanel和GridPanel配合得蛮好,能大大提升用户体验哦。如果你在做类似项目,学会怎么配置这些组件对你来说会有,直接提升开发效率。
在实现时,关注下事件监听的,比如监听树的itemclick
事件,或者直接用表格的store
来绑定树的选择项变化,避免手动刷新表格。建议先搞清楚树的TreeStore
和表格的store
配置,灵活利用它们之间的联动。
如果你有时间,看看压缩包中的Extjs 入门教程,上面有多关于如何配置树和表格的细节步骤,包括如何解析 XML 或者 JSON 数据源,怎么做布局,甚至如何给组件加上自定义行为。
Ext树和表格的示例
预估大小:347个文件
button.css
4KB
tree.css
6KB
window.css
4KB
grid.css
13KB
toolbar.css
5KB
panel.css
8KB
editor.css
2KB
date-picker.css
5KB
qtips.css
3KB
xtheme-gray.css
9KB
738.98KB
文件大小:
评论区